How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 95219?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 95219 Studio Apartments | $1,608 | $1,250 | $2,549 |
| 95219 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,642 | $750 | $2,119 |
| 95219 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,047 | $1,250 | $2,305 |
| 95219 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,322 | $2,000 | $2,545 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 95219 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 95219?
There are currently 20 Studio Apartments in 95219 with rent ranges from $1,250 to $2,549 with an average price of $1,608.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 95219 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 95219 ranges from $750 to $2,119 with an average monthly rent of $1,642.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 95219 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 95219 range from $1,250 to $2,305.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,047.
How expensive are 95219 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 63 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 95219 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,000 to $2,545 - averaging $2,322 for the location.
